Dell Mini 10 Netbook: UK specs and price

Dell has officially announced the launch of the Mini 10 netbook and has a UK release date of February 26. After months of speculation over what the specs and price will be, Dell thought it was about time they put us out of our misery.

The Dell Mini 10 netbook comes with a 16:9 display and has a 10.1-inch screen, the whole thing weighs 1.3kg, which seems a bit heavy for a netbook. So let us look inside and see what is weighing the thing down.

The keyboard is 92 percent the size of a standard keyboard, with a touchpad that offers full multi-touch gestures. The netbook is powered by an Intel Atom CPU and has 1GB of RAM and 160GB hard drive. The Dell Mini 10 runs on Windows XP SP3. Connectivity is not bad either; there is a card reader, Bluetooth, a HDMI port and USB2.0.

The Dell Mini 10 comes in five colors; these include black, white, green, blue, pink and red. The price should be around £299.
